当前位置:首页 » 编程语言 » sqlupper

sqlupper

发布时间: 2025-09-24 18:55:02

sql如何将二个字段连接在一起

在SQL中,将两个字段合并是一项基本操作,可以使用连接符实现。方法一,对于大部分数据库系统,如MySQL、Oracle和DB2,你可以使用“||”作为连接符,例如:

在SQL查询中,如:SELECTname||'的年龄是'||ageFROMtablename;这将返回"zhangsna的年龄是11"这样的结果。

而对于SQLServer,由于语法差异,你可能需要使用加号“+”来连接字段,如:SELECTfield1+''+field2FROMtab;这里的空格是通过字符串连接实现的。

值得注意的是,尽管SQL是关系数据库的强大工具,它结合了关系代数的某些特性,同时还具备自己独特的功能,如聚集操作和数据库更新。尽管功能强大,但SQL语言设计简洁,核心操作只有9个动词。

在实际操作中,SQL还提供了丰富的函数来处理字符串连接,比如:

  • upper():将字符串转为大写,如:SELECTupper('example');
  • lower():将字符串转为小写,如:SELECTlower('EXAMPLE');
  • space():生成指定数量的空格,如:SELECTspace(5);
  • replicate():复制字符串指定次数,如:SELECTreplicate('a',3);
  • reverse():反转字符串,如:SELECTreverse('abc');
  • stuff():替换字符串中的部分,如:SELECTstuff('hello',2,1,'world');

了解这些基础知识和函数后,你可以更有效地在SQL中连接和操作字段。希望这些信息对你有所帮助!

Ⅱ SQL语句将字符串型转化为整数型的函数是什么

我关于sql函数方面的搜集资料。看了对函数你可能就会了解一些了。。。。首先楼主 写的那条语句 绝对不能执行。。应该这样写
USE 数据库名
GO
SELECT DISTINCT cuser
FROM cat
WHERE time ='' or time >'' or time <''
ORDER BY time
DESC

GO

你如果想把某列,或者某字段 的数据 由 乱七八糟的转换成大写的 用这个 函数 UPPER
用法 UPPER (某字段)

关于sql函数详解 如下:

SQL函数,详细描述如下: Avg函数 Avg函数,计算查询中某一特定字段资料的算术平均值。 语法为Avg(运算式)。运算式,可为字段名称、运算式、或一个函数,此函数可 以是一个内部或使用者定义的,但不能为其它的SQL函数。 Avg函数在计算时,不包含任何值为 Null 的资料。 Count函数 Count函数,计算符合查询条件的记录条数。 语法为Count (运算式)。运算式,可为字段名称、*、多个字段名称、运算式、 或一个函数,此函数可以是一个内部或使用者定义的,但不能为其它的SQL函数。 Count 函数于计算时,不包含任何值为 Null 的资料。 但是,Count(*) 则计算所有符合查询条件的记录条数,包含那些Null的资料。 如果Count(字段名称) 的字段名称为多个字段,将字段名称之间使用 & 分隔。 多个字段当中,至少有一个字段的值不为Null的情况下,Count函数才会计算为一条 记录。如果多个字段都为Null,则不算是一条记录。譬如: SELECT Count(价格 & 代号) From 产品 First/Last函数 First函数、Last函数,传回指定字段之中符合查询条件的第一条、最末条记录 的资料。 语法为First(运算式) 和 Last(运算式)。运算式,可为字段名称、运算式、或 一个函数,此函数可以是一个内部或使用者定义的,但不能为其它的SQL函数。 Min/Max函数 Min函数、Max函数,传回指定字段之中符合查询条件的最小值、最大值。 语法为Min(运算式) 和 Max(运算式)。运算式,可为字段名称、运算式、或一个 函数,此函数可以是一个内部或使用者定义的,但不能为其它的SQL函数。 StDev函数 StDev函数,计算指定字段之中符合查询条件的标准差。 语法为StDev(运算式)。运算式,可为字段名称、运算式、或一个函数,此函数 可以是一个内部或使用者定义的,但不能为其它的SQL函数。 如果符合查询条件的记录为两个以下时,StDev函数将传回一个Null 值,该表示 不能计算标准差。 Sum函数 Sum函数,计算指定字段之中符合查询条件的资料总和。 语法为Sum(运算式)。运算式,可为字段名称、运算式、或一个函数,此函数可 以是一个内部或使用者定义的,但不能为其它的SQL函数。 Sum函数可使用两个字段资料运算式,譬如计算产品的单价及数量字段的合计: SELECT Sum(单价 * 数量) FROM 产品 Var函数 Var函数,计算指定字段之中符合查询条件的变异数估计值。 语法为Var(运算式)。运算式,可为字段名称、运算式、或一个函数,此函数可 以是一个内部或使用者定义的,但不能为其它的SQL函数。 如果符合查询条件的记录为两个以下时,Var函数将传回一个Null 值,该表示不 能计算变异数。

Ⅲ Oracle数据库操作时如何使用LOWER()、UPPER()函数

1、lower():大写字符转化成小写的函数

使用举例:select lower(表中字段) from 表名

该sql实现将表里的字段信息中含有字母的全部转成小写。

2、upper():小写字符转化成大写的函数

使用举例:select upper(表中字段) from 表名

该sql实现将 user表里的字段信息中含有字母的全部转成大写。

(3)sqlupper扩展阅读

oracle常用函数介绍:

1、CONCAT(X,Y):连接字符串X和Y;

2、LENGTH(X):返回X的长度;

3、REPLACE(X,old,new):在X中查找old,并替换成new;

4、SUBSTR(X,start[,length]):返回X的字串,从start处开始,截取length个字符,缺省length,默认到结尾;

5、TRUNC(X[,Y]):X在第Y位截断;

6、COUNT():数据统计;

7、MIN()、MAX():最小值、最大值。



Ⅳ 求一SQL语句把身份带X的小写改大写

用函数upper就可以处理了
UPPER
返回将小写字符数据转换为大写的字符表达式。

update farmer
set sfzh = UPPER(sfzh)
where sfzh='53220119740820511x'

热点内容
瀑布线源码 发布:2025-09-24 20:33:41 浏览:414
安卓手机tif卡怎么装 发布:2025-09-24 20:20:54 浏览:424
javaandroid开发视频 发布:2025-09-24 19:59:08 浏览:798
新浪云存储怎么用 发布:2025-09-24 19:52:41 浏览:466
主机服务器连接电脑 发布:2025-09-24 19:39:36 浏览:268
怎样连接加密的wifi密码 发布:2025-09-24 19:23:03 浏览:772
c语言学习哪家好 发布:2025-09-24 19:09:04 浏览:815
sqlupper 发布:2025-09-24 18:55:02 浏览:323
我的世界工业服务器地址 发布:2025-09-24 18:40:17 浏览:704
快赞能用脚本 发布:2025-09-24 18:39:44 浏览:400